Package: vim
Version: 1:7.0-017+7
Severity: normal

netrw fails to write through scp a file. Here's the complaint:
 "scp://foo/bar"
 Error detected while processing function netrw#NetWrite:
 line  219:
 "scp://foo/bar" E212: Can't open file for writing
 :!scp -q /tmp/v123456/7 'foo:bar'

The problem does not occur if a file is unmodified.
